Attribute: LW_METHOD

code  description    
LWI014    Longwave incoming solar radiation is measured by a Hukseflux NR01, 4-component net radiation sensor (upward and downward facing sensors measure both longwave and shortwave solar radiation components and sensor temperature) with a Campbell Scientific data logger attached to the tower at 600 cm height; values are output every 5 minutes (see Method NRT014)    
LWI015   Longwave incoming solar radiation is measured by a heated Hukseflux NR01, 4-component net radiation sensor (upward and downward facing sensors measure both longwave and shortwave solar radiation components and sensor temperature) with a Campbell Scientific data logger attached to the tower at 600 cm height; values are output every 5 minutes (see Method NRT015)    
LWI016   Longwave incoming solar radiation is measured by a heated (dewpoint trigger) Hukseflux NR01, 4-component net radiation sensor (upward and downward facing sensors measure both longwave and shortwave solar radiation components and sensor temperature) with a Campbell Scientific data logger attached to the tower at 600 cm height; values are output every 5 minutes (see Method NRT015)    
LWI114    Daily longwave incoming solar radiation is post-calculated from 5-minute data output from a Hukseflux NR01, 4-component net radiation sensor (upward and downward longwave and shortwave) with a Campbell Scientific data logger; 600 cm height (see Method LWI014)    
LWO014    Longwave outgoing solar radiation is measured by a Hukseflux NR01, 4-component net radiation sensor (upward and downward facing sensors measure both longwave and shortwave solar radiation components and sensor temperature) with a Campbell Scientific data logger attached to the tower at 600 cm height; values are output every 5 minutes (see Method NRT014)    
LWO015   Longwave outgoing solar radiation is measured by a heated Hukseflux NR01, 4-component net radiation sensor (upward and downward facing sensors measure both longwave and shortwave solar radiation components and sensor temperature) with a Campbell Scientific data logger attached to the tower at 600 cm height; values are output every 5 minutes (see Method NRT015)    
LWO016   Longwave outgoing solar radiation is measured by a heated (dewpoint trigger) Hukseflux NR01, 4-component net radiation sensor (upward and downward facing sensors measure both longwave and shortwave solar radiation components and sensor temperature) with a Campbell Scientific data logger attached to the tower at 600 cm height; values are output every 5 minutes (see Method NRT015)    
LWO114    Daily longwave outgoing solar radiation is post-calculated from 5-minute data output from a Hukseflux NR01, 4-component net radiation sensor (upward and downward longwave and shortwave) with a Campbell Scientific data logger; 600 cm height (see Method LWO014)
